Output 5c38bbe65a26ac2489b741fc65f95d35b9f23fc34a05e609df9f18c02ca7ebbd:4

value
8729943
script pubkey
OP_0 OP_PUSHBYTES_20 dddd55d75566375c749bad15fdfdc65b8893d990
address
bc1qmhw4t464vcm4caym452lmlwxtwyf8kvsyt8kqx
transaction
5c38bbe65a26ac2489b741fc65f95d35b9f23fc34a05e609df9f18c02ca7ebbd
spent
true